Figure 4.7 Comparison of Gauss and Taner filter performance in extracting a precession index signal from 65° North
summer half-year insolation (La2004 model; Chapter 5) sampled at Δt = 1 kyr from 36 to 40 Ma. (a) Summer half-year
mean insolation for 65°North, calculated with Analyseries 2.0.4. (b) Same as (a) plus white Gaussian noise with variance
equal to that of the insolation. (c) Gauss band-pass filtered series of the precession band insolation. (d) Taner band-pass
filtered series of the precession band insolation. (e) The actual precession index used to compute (a). The applied filters
were defined with the parameters indicated in Figure 4.6. The precession-filtered summer insolation has opposite polarity
to the precession index (see Chapter 5).
